Also known as Kennesaw
Where: Logan County, Colorado (40.9° N, 103.5° W: paleocoordinates 41.5° N, 100.3° W)
• coordinate stated in text
When: Pawnee Creek Formation, Barstovian (16.3 - 12.5 Ma)
• "lower part of Pawnee Creek formation, associated with Kennesaw local fauna, Upper Miocene" and therefore Barstovian, but physically nowhere near the Kennesaw collections per se
Environment/lithology: fluvial-lacustrine; lithology not reported
Size class: macrofossils
Collected by E. C. Galbreath
• Southern Illinois University collection postdating Galbreath 1953
Primary reference: P. Brodkorb. 1972. Neogene fossil jays from the Great Plains. The Condor 74(3):347-349 [J. Alroy/J. Alroy]more details
Purpose of describing collection: taxonomic analysis
